When the chips are down on the table, you want a superstar on your side. That’s what the Milwaukee Bucks had on Sunday as they took down the Los Angeles Clippers thanks to Giannis Antetokounmpo and a late rally saw them overcome what looked like being almost a certain defeat. Down 100-96 late, they went on to score nine consecutive points to close out the game and take a 105-100 victory.

Giannis scored 36 points in total for the game, but it was perhaps his influence on the defensive side of the ball that was most impressive. The Bucks showed their defensive fortitude in the final minutes, not allowing the Clippers to make a single basket in the last four minutes of action. But he also did outscore the Clippers by himself in the last eight and a half minutes, scoring 17 to the Clips’ ten. That’s now five wins in a row for the Bucks, who are rolling and looking like the kind of team that we all know them to be. The Clippers who got 25 from Kawhi Leonard but no more than 16 from anyone else, fell to 24-12 with the loss while the Bucks climbed up to 21-13 with the ‘W.’
